Kenkanali Population - Paschim Medinipur, West Bengal
Kenkanali is a medium size village located in Garbeta - II Block of Paschim Medinipur district, West Bengal with total 158 families residing. The Kenkanali village has population of 764 of which 367 are males while 397 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kenkanali village population of children with age 0-6 is 83 which makes up 10.86 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kenkanali village is 1082 which is higher than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Kenkanali as per census is 1677, higher than West Bengal average of 956.
Kenkanali village has lower liter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Kenkanali village was 74.30 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Kenkanali Male literacy stands at 83.04 % while female literacy rate was 65.80 %.

Kenkanali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 158 | - | - |
Population | 764 | 367 | 397 |
Child (0-6) | 83 | 31 | 52 |
Schedule Caste | 74 | 30 | 44 |
Schedule Tribe | 6 | 3 | 3 |
Literacy | 74.30 % | 83.04 % | 65.80 % |
Total Workers | 395 | 225 | 170 |
Main Worker | 175 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 220 | 77 | 143 |
